Caitlin Pearl (they/them) is a facilitator, artist, and educator who helps create caring and radically inclusive learning environments. They are the founder of The Reframe Collective, a constellation of micro-schools and creative cohorts that center community care, self-expression, and joyful learning. Caitlin creates spaces where people of all ages feel free to explore, express, become, and feel like they belong. Their offerings include The Re.Imaginaries Preschool, The Tool School, and The Rainbow School, which together support children, youth, and adults through creative exploration, identity transitions, and collaborative learning.
Their work centers queer, neurodivergent, and immunocompromised community members, and is rooted in ritual, creativity, relationship, and wonder. Caitlin’s offerings draw from over 20 years of teaching, parenting, and imagining freer futures.
When they’re not guiding groups through transformation, Caitlin loves working one-on-one with individuals around their clothing and personal style through Wardrobe Resourcery. They offer wardrobe trades, new-to-you treasure bundles, and styling sessions—both virtually and in person—with shipping available for those at a distance.
